Step 1: Preparation for the Herbed Greek Potato Wedges
- 2 lbs. baby red potatoes
- Olive oil – 1/3 cup
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on Kosher salt
- 1/4 teaspoon fresh cracked pepper
- 1/4 cup fresh chopped dill
- Zest of 1 lemon
Step 2: Cooking the Herbed Greek Potato Wedges
Preheat your oven to 450 degrees Fahrenheit and line a ba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up. Start by cutting your baby red potatoes into wedges. Aim for about 4-6 wedges per potato, depending on their size, to ensure even cooking.
In a small mixing bowl, combine the olive oil, dried oregano, dried rosemary, garlic powder, paprika, Kosher salt, and fresh cracked pepper. Mix well until the spices are evenly distributed in the oil. Pour this seasoning mixture over the prepared potato wedges, tossing them in a large bowl until well coated.
Spread the seasoned wedges in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et. Bake for 15 minutes, then carefully flip the wedges to promote even browning. Continue baking for another 15 minutes. For an extra crispy finish, increase the oven temperature to 500 degrees and bake for an additional 15 minutes, flipping the wedges one final time and baking for another 5-10 minutes until the desired crispiness is achieved.
Step 3: Assembling and Finishing
As soon as the Herbed Greek Potato Wedges are done baking, remove them from the oven and gently toss them with the fresh chopped dill and lemon zest. This step infuses the potato wedges with a burst of fresh flavor that beautifully complements the roasted herbs and spices.
Serve these aromatic wedges warm, paired with a cool, creamy yogurt sauce for dipping. They’ll make an irresistible side dish or appetizer that everyone will reach for.

Tips for the Best Herbed Greek Potato Wedges Every Time
- Uniform Cutting: Ensure that all potato wedges are cut to a similar size. This allows for even cooking and perfect texture throughout.
- Opt for Fresh Herbs: If possible, choose fresh herbs over dried for an even more aromatic and flavorful finish.
- Parchment Paper: Using parchment paper not only makes for an easy cleanup but also helps the wedges develop a beautiful, crispy crust.

Herbed Greek Potato Wedges
- Total Time: 1 hr
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
The fragrant aroma wafting through your kitchen signals that a delightful experience awaits with Herbed Greek Potato Wedges. These savory wedges, infused with aromatic herbs and spices, transform an ordinary side dish into something extraordinary. Herbed Greek Potato Wedges are more than just a dish; they’re a symphony of flavor that promises to bring a touch of the Mediterranean to your table. And let’s not forget, a healthy dip of cool, creamy yogurt sauce adds that perfect finish, making them the best potato wedges for every occasion.
Ingredients
- 2 lbs. baby red potatoes
- 1/3 cup olive oil
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on Kosher salt
- 1/4 teaspoon fresh cracked pepper
- 1/4 cup fresh chopped dill
- Zest of 1 lemon
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 450°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Cut baby red potatoes into wedges (4-6 per potato).
- Combine olive oil, oregano, rosemary, garlic powder, paprika, Kosher salt, and pepper in a mixing bowl.
- Toss potato wedges in the seasoning mixture until well coated.
- Spread wedges in a single layer on the baking sheet and bake for 15 minutes.
- Flip wedges and bake for another 15 minutes.
- Increase oven temperature to 500°F and bake for an additional 15 minutes, flipping once.
- Remove from oven and toss with fresh dill and lemon zest.
- Serve warm with a yogurt sauce for dipping.
Notes
- Ensure wedges are cut uniformly for even cooking.
- Fresh herbs can be used for enhanced flavor.
- Parchment paper aids in achieving a crispy texture.
